1-27-09 (at school)

CG Bench:
up to
155x3
175x3

Dips: 2 sets
Rolling DB Extensions: 3x12
One Arm Rows: 3 sets
Seated Rows: 2 sets
Pushdowns: 2 sets

Ok workout. I will probably just bench higher reps at school (8-10 reps), because the competition bench racks are all messed up. There are 3 settings on the rack, the second is way too short as i'm unracking from a 1/2 ROM, and the highest is just slightly too high to try and rack with heavy weight.

Not only that, but i don't trust the guys i lift with, because their hand offs are really pretty awful. They lift it off, then just let go right away... no easing off when they release.

Oh well, i never bench higher reps, so at least i'll probably see a little bit of strength gain from it, and a little change of pace. I'll still press heavy another day of the week.

1-30-09:
Good workout today at Chad's:

Axle Clean+jerk:
95x2
115x3
135x2
150x2
160x1x2 (continential cleaned these sets and the next)
155x2
135x5

BA Pullups:
3x6

SSB Squats:
145x5
added briefs b/c of hip
195x5 (beltless)
215x3
245x3
275x1
300x1 (pr. 1st 300lb squat)
225x5

Face Pulls: 2 light sets, then 2 sets of 8-10 reps w/ the cable stack (170lbs)

Grip Machine up to:
100x3+ 20 second hold
115x3+ 15 second hold
130x3 +15 second hold

Pushdowns:
100x15
130x10

Lots of volume, but everything felt good! Going to take a nap now, and then (hopefully) play with my ipod if the mail carrier delivers it today.
